Trench Removal and Site Restoration in C1 area at CFB Wainwright

The Proposed Project

The Department of national Defence is proposing to remove trench materials in the Range and Training Area C1. Trench materials are corrugated steel sheets with wood and metal stakes. Total approximate trench area of 468 square meters. The project work also includes site restoration. The project will occur in the Range Training Area (RTA) at Wainwright


Latest update

September 9, 2020 – The Department of National Defence issued its Notice of Determination and determined that the project is not likely to cause significant adverse environmental effects.
